"Ever wanted to remix your favorite Video Game song? Unfortunately, we're not all prodigies like the OC Remix guys. Here's a video tutorial that will help you make a song you're proud of in less than 10 MINUTES!"

If you've ever been to www.OCRemix.org, or www.VGMix.com, and you've heard some of the works, you know that the music these guys and girls put out is awesome, for free stuff. They purchase high-end equipment and spend many hours, and days into their remixes, which should show why they'd be cheesed off at the program in question, Reason Adapted.

This program takes midi-files, which can be downloaded for free at vgmusic.com to name a site, and throws new instrument samples over the midi lines. Easy to do in a minutes after learning what to do.

If you watch the QuickTime, you'll hear a sample of what the TopaZ, the creator of the QuickTime tutorial, created. Crappy quality.

If someone were to wish to get into VG-mixing, this might be a first good step, but don't send the final creations to vgmix or ocremix. You'll be blacklisted in a heartbeat.
